During most of the Holocene, the glaciers in Bockfjorden were less extensive than they are today. Their maximum Holocene extension occurred during the Little Ice Age. The initial shoreline emergence after the deglaciation was rapid, and former shorelines younger than 8. 5 Ky [thousand years] are below the present sea level. 2, record 1, English, - initial%20shoreline

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 DEF
The initial stage of fast ice formation consisting of nilas or young ice, its width varying from a few metres up to 100-200 m from the shoreline. 2, record 2, English, - young%20coastal%20ice
